A man who doused himself in petrol and set himself alight in Tauranga has died from his injuries.
The man was taken to hospital in a critical condition on 20 September after emergency services were called to a street corner in the city.
A police spokesperson said the man was badly burned with self-inflicted burns. He was transferred to the intensive care unit at Auckland's Middlemore hospital but a hospital spokesperson confirmed today that the man died on Friday.
The police had referred the death to the coroner.
